What is the difference between Disc and Drum brakes?

Drum brakes are normal brakes whereas disc are for instant braking and locking of the vehicle. the stopping power increases with diac brake and the distance of stopping reduces compared to drum brakes. But keep in mind disc brakes are naughty in wet and loose mud roads.
